    From Soft Serve to Stand-Up Comedy: Turner Sparks’ Excellent Chinese Misadventure

    In a mildly confusing bit of podcast naming, Jared Turner sits down with comedian Turner Sparks.  Turner moved to China in 2004 to teach English, planning to stay for just one year. He ended up staying for twelve. In this episode of You Can Learn Chinese, Turner talks about learning Chinese out of necessity, from struggling through everyday conversations with almost no shared language to using Chinese while building and running a business across China. Turner shares stories from his years in Suzhou and Shanghai, including launching Mr. Softee ice cream trucks in China, navigating local government and business culture, whitewater rafting with Chinese officials, and stumbling into stand-up comedy when a local bar owner built him a stage and told him he had a month to prepare. That hobby eventually became a career. After performing around Asia, Turner moved to New York City to pursue comedy full time, where his years in China, his Chinese-speaking wife and family, and the Chinese language itself continue to shape his comedy. Turner’s path from English teacher to ice cream entrepreneur to full-time comedian is not exactly the standard Chinese-learning story. Join us for a funny and unpredictable conversation about China, Chinese, business, comedy, and the strange places learning a language can take you.     Learning Chinese Through the Lens of a Camera with Jake Hines

    What happens when a childhood choice turns into a life-changing career change? In this episode, Jared talks with Jake Hines, an Australian content creator based in Xiamen, China, whose Chinese learning journey began in high school thanks to a nudge from his mom. After years working as an engineering project manager, Jake left his stable career during COVID to pursue a very different path: traveling through China, creating videos, and rebuilding his life around the language he had once studied as a teenager. Jake shares how early trips to Nanjing sparked his fascination with Chinese, why he sees language learning as a form of “Type II Fun,” and how the challenge of Mandarin became part of its appeal. He also explains how creating Chinese-language content has become one of his most powerful learning tools. From filming conversations with locals to translating, subtitling, and editing the same footage over and over, Jake discovered that video creation can turn real-world Chinese into deeply memorable comprehensible input. The conversation also explores Jake’s experiences studying at Xiamen University, making friends through Chinese, learning through graded readers and podcasts, and building a media career in China. He shares the story of winning an award for a video about Dehua porcelain and being flown to Beijing to speak on a live panel in Chinese. Jake’s practical advice: find a personal project that makes Chinese useful, consume content you genuinely enjoy, talk to yourself in Chinese, and embrace mistakes as part of the process.
